Location-based advertising has evolved dramatically from its humble beginnings of simple geo-fence tests. Today, retail, QSR and auto brands are leading the way and running sophisticated campaigns that are delivering meaningful metrics. Join a stellar group of marketers and mobile experts from Verve Mobile, xAd and YP, to hear the 3 most important insights from each industry category on how applying location intelligence to mobile campaigns will drive measurable ROI. These insights are based on thousands of campaigns in 2013 and 2014 - don't miss this data-rich discussion! •  Geo-Fencing

•  Identifies a point of interest on a map and establishes a

radius around it for targeting purposes.

•  Geo-Conquesting

•  Uses location data to identify a brand’s competitors in an

effort to promote a competing or competitive offering to

their customers.

•  Geo-Behavioral/Location-Based Audiences

•  The ability to target unique audiences and/or users based

on the context of a given location, past or present location

behaviors etc.

•  Retargeting

•  Re-messaging to users based on past offline and online

visitation behaviors

MOBILE ADVERTISING���MORE THAN JUST PROXIMITY TARGETING

2. TIMING IS EVERYTHING

Over 60% of mobile restaurant users look to make a purchase within the hour Source: xAd/Telmetrics Mobile Path to Purchase Study - Restaurants

Marry Immediacy with Context

•  Time of Day and Day of Week targeted campaigns satisfy both convenience and user intent

•  Don’t assume consumers will remember your breakfast ad if served during the lunch hour

3. KEEP IT SIMPLE

19 Source: xAd/Telmetrics Mobile Path to Purchase Study - Restaurants

Fancy, Fluffy Ad Creative is Seldom “Quick”

•  QSR ad creative should include location, deal or offer, and a direct call to action

•  Ads direct to landing pages with nearest location information and preferred actions such as map & driving directions

Decisions are made quickly. Make sure every second counts by providing users quick access to the information they need.

GOAL: Drive foot traffic into Pinkberry stores and generate awareness of current promotional offers to try the new Pinkberry greek yogurt.

SOLUTION: Leverage geo-fencing combined with an audience target to reach Pinkberry’s Ideal audience.

RESULTS The campaign doubled Pinkberry's performance benchmark

CLIENT SUCCESS STORY: PINKBERRY

SUCCESS STORY: QUIZNOS

“Must have a testing mentality -- always,” Tim Kraus, Director of Digital Marketing, Quiznos.

Quiznos has been testing with Sense Networks/YP since 2012 over several campaigns to learn what works best in their business.

Targeting: •  San Francisco, Madison, Seattle test markets •  Competitors’ customers (Subway, McDonald’s, Wendy’s)

•  Within 10 miles of locations

Results: • 6% lift in sales over national average

2. SOMETIMES LOCATION DOESN’T MATTER...

Distance to Store

CTR

< .5 mi 0.77%

.5-1 mi. 0.79%

1-3 mi. 0.80%

3-5 mi. 0.78%

5-8 mi. 0.80%

8-10 mi. 0.79%

10+ mi. 0.80%

Contrary to popular belief, there is not always a relationship between real-time distance to retail store and clicks.

Red=  campaigns,  series  A  Blue  =  campaigns,  series  B  Source:  YP/Sense  Networks  

hJp://naOonal.yp.com/mobile  

Page 30: The Top 3 Location-Based Advertising Insights Across Retail, QSR and Auto

… AT LEAST NOT HOW YOU THINK…

Home/work location and attributes extracted from location data can drive greater lift in results.

Especially for national brands with many well-known locations in a metro area other targeting will have a greater impact on response than being “1 mile from a retail store.”

SUCCESS STORY: COLUMBIA

Campaign Goals: To increase awareness around Columbia’s Omni-Heat jacket and incent mobile users to come in-store to try it on

Solution: •  Users were targeted in and around locations offering the

new Omni-Heat jacket with a location-aware message

•  Post click, users were taken to a custom landing page showing contact details for the nearest store location and a special offer

Results: •  CTR was 52% above the industry average •  Driving directions and an exclusive offer that could be

redeemed at retail locations were the highest secondary actions

ADVERTISING OBJECTIVES FOR AUTO VARY BY “TIER”

Auto mobile strategy varies depending on funding source:

TIER 1: NATIONAL/BRANDING Objective: Increase awareness and shift consideration

TIER 2: REGIONAL DEALER GROUPS Drive qualified leads and promote regional incentives

TIER 3: LOCAL DEALER Reach in-market shoppers and drive foot traffic to individual dealerships

GEO-CONQUESTING Reach consumers visiting competitor lots.

GEO-FENCING Reach consumers near dealership: fencing proximity based on machine learnings.

RETARGETING Reach consumers after they visit lot or competitor dealerships for 30 days, anytime/anywhere.

AUDIENCE TARGETING Target custom audiences based primarily on a combination of activity in the physical world; and HH matching data.

ZIP+4 CODE TARGETING Target key zip codes for specific Models based on Polk sales data.

AUTO CATEGORY

AUTO OVERALL MOST EFFECTIVE LOCATION TACTICS

BEACON TRIGGERED MESSAGING/OFFERS: Targeted ads integrated into Beacon technology.

HH MATCHING/ “PATH” OVERLAY: Target based on HH to Device matching Auto data and optimize for path to purchase.

“PATH” TARGETING Targeting locations that are seen on path to dealer lots, e.g., relevant Starbucks locations..

Page 48: The Top 3 Location-Based Advertising Insights Across Retail, QSR and Auto

Geo-Fencing/Geo-Conquesting: Geo fencing lots and competitive lots.

Zip+ 4 Targeting: Using Polk reg. data, targeting neighborhood blocks that are in top percentages for target prospects based on relevant auto registration data, e.g., own sub-compact over two years old.

Audience Targeting: Using HH matching, Polk data and demographics matching data.

TIER 2: TOP TACTICS THAT WORK

Path Targeting Target using daypart and locations frequently seen prior to lot visits, e.g., Starbucks.

Geo-Retargeting Retarget those on relevant lots in past 30 days.

1. Person near the dealership location (lat / long) sees product offer on their iPhone

2. While in the dealer, the iBeacon triggers the offer to display

3. Customer redeems incentive with dealer

FREE  GIFT  FREE  GIFT  WITH  

A  TEST  DRIVE  FREE  GIFT  WITH  A  TEST  DRIVE  

4. Beacons then provide “micro-location" data that gives dealerships insights into customers and close loop from impression to attribution

TIER 3 MICRO-LOCATION TACTICS THAT WORK
